📘 What Is the FRCPath Part 1 Medical Microbiology Exam?

The FRCPath Part 1 exam is designed by the Royal College of Pathologists (RCPath), UK, to assess theoretical knowledge required for safe clinical practice. It's particularly relevant for doctors training in medical microbiology, infection, and allied specialities.


🧪 Exam Format

  • Type: Two papers (Paper 1 and Paper 2)

  • Mode: Computer-based (at Pearson VUE centers or remotely)

  • Paper 1:

    • 125 single-best-answer (SBA) MCQs

    • Time: 3 hours

  • Paper 2:

    • 125 single-best-answer (SBA) MCQs

    • Time: 3 hours

  • Topics Covered:

    • Bacteriology

    • Virology

    • Mycology

    • Parasitology

    • Infection control

    • Antimicrobial stewardship

    • Laboratory management

    • Epidemiology and public health microbiology


📚 Detailed Syllabus Overview

The syllabus includes:

  • Microbial Pathogenesis: Structure, replication, and virulence mechanisms

  • Diagnostic Microbiology: Culturing, microscopy, molecular techniques

  • Antimicrobials: Mechanisms, resistance, prescribing principles

  • Clinical Syndromes: Respiratory, CNS, GI, bloodstream infections

  • Infection Control: Surveillance, outbreaks, hospital policies

  • Laboratory Management: Quality assurance, ISO standards

  • Immunology: Host responses, vaccines

  • Epidemiology: Outbreak investigation, statistics





🎯 Preparation Strategy for Success

  1. Understand the Blueprint

    • Study RCPath syllabus + previous sample questions

    • Focus on high-yield infectious syndromes and organisms

  2. Create a 12-24 Week Study Plan

    • Allocate weekly time for bacteriology, virology, mycology, parasitology

    • Reserve the last 2 weeks for revision and mock tests

  3. Use High-Yield Resources

    • Murray’s Medical Microbiology

    • Jawetz Melnick & Adelberg’s

    • Oxford Handbook of Infectious Diseases

    • FRCPathPrep.com MCQ Bank

  4. Practice with MCQs Daily

    • Aim for at least 25–30 questions per day

    • Review answers and read explanations in detail

  5. Join a Study Group

    • Discuss questions and clinical cases weekly

    • Peer discussions improve retention and motivation

✅ Pro Tips from Past Candidates

  • Focus on UK-based guidelines (UKHSA, NICE, BSAC)

  • Practice time-bound MCQ sets

  • Clarify confusing areas early (e.g., resistance mechanisms, surveillance definitions)

  • Use spaced repetition and active recall
